Job Description

We are looking for a Dispatcher to support daily service coordination for a Contract position based in Waterbury, Connecticut. This opportunity is ideal for someone who can manage incoming requests, organize schedules, and keep communication flowing between customers, field teams, and internal staff. The role requires strong customer service skills, sound judgment, and the ability to handle dispatch activity efficiently in a fast-paced construction and contractor environment.
Responsibilities:
  • Coordinate daily dispatch activity by assigning service calls and work orders based on priority, availability, and location.
  • Respond to customer inquiries by phone and provide clear, thorough updates regarding schedules, service timing, and request status.
  • Maintain accurate records in dispatch and scheduling systems to ensure job details, technician assignments, and service notes are current.
  • Work closely with field personnel to adjust routes, confirm appointment windows, and address unexpected scheduling changes throughout the day.
  • Create and manage appointments for service visits while balancing workload demands and operational efficiency.
  • Review incoming work requests for completeness and route them to the appropriate teams for timely execution.
  • Communicate with internal departments and external contacts to support smooth logistics coordination across active jobs.
  • Monitor open assignments and follow up as needed to help ensure work orders are completed and documented properly.
